Situated on a rise, in pasture. A ringfort (WM030-063----) lies c. 90m to S. Depicted on the revised 1910 ed. OS 25-inch map as a roughly trapezoidal-shaped earthwork. Monument described in 1964 as a relatively small D-shaped area enclosed by a low bank of earth and stone. Levelled monument described in 1973 as a faint traces of a levelled scarp which is best preserved along the W side. Levelled monument is visible today as a faint roughly D-shaped cropmark on Digital Globe aerial photography.
Compiled by Alison McQueen, Vera Rahilly and Caimin O’Brien.
